What Is an Infusion Pump?

An infusion pump is a medical device used to deliver fluids, medications, nutrients, blood products, and specialty therapies directly to patients with a high degree of accuracy. Infusion pumps are commonly used in hospitals, outpatient facilities, surgical centers, long-term care facilities, and home healthcare settings where precise medication administration is essential.

Modern infusion pumps often include:

  • Drug library functionality
  • Dose error reduction software (DERS)
  • Wireless connectivity
  • EMR integration capabilities
  • Safety alarms and monitoring features
  • Multi-channel infusion options
  • Customizable medication protocols

These features help healthcare facilities improve patient safety, standardize medication delivery, and reduce medication administration errors.

Popular Refurbished Infusion Pump Models

Alaris Medley Infusion Systems

The Alaris Medley platform remains one of the most widely used infusion systems in hospitals nationwide. Modular configurations allow facilities to combine infusion, syringe, PCA, and monitoring modules into a single integrated platform. The Alaris 8100 Infusion Module and 8015 Point of Care Unit continue to be popular choices for facilities seeking fleet expansion or replacement units.

Baxter Spectrum IQ Infusion Pump

The Baxter Spectrum IQ is a smart infusion pump designed to support medication safety initiatives through drug library compliance, EMR integration, barcode-assisted workflows, and wireless communication. Many healthcare facilities choose Spectrum IQ systems when looking to standardize infusion therapy across multiple departments.

Baxter Sigma Spectrum Infusion Pump

The Baxter Sigma Spectrum offers Dose Error Reduction Software (DERS), wireless capabilities, and Continuous Quality Improvement (CQI) reporting tools. Its lightweight design and intuitive interface make it a popular choice for hospitals and infusion clinics.

Hospira Plum 360 Infusion Pump

The Hospira Plum 360 provides advanced medication delivery capabilities with dose rate programming, IV-EHR interoperability, and unique air management technology. The platform remains a widely utilized infusion solution throughout acute care environments.

B. Braun Infusomat Space

The B. Braun Infusomat Space is known for its compact footprint, modular design, and flexibility in hospital and alternate care settings. These systems are commonly used in facilities looking to maximize bedside space while maintaining infusion accuracy.

Important Software Compatibility Considerations

One of the most important factors when purchasing refurbished infusion pumps is software compatibility. Before adding devices to an existing fleet, healthcare facilities should verify:

  • Software revision levels
  • Drug library compatibility
  • Existing infusion protocols
  • Wireless communication requirements
  • EMR integration needs
  • Included accessories and mounting hardware

Ensuring compatibility before purchase helps prevent integration issues and supports consistent medication administration practices across departments.
